Product Description:
The CSH01.3C-PL-ENS-NNN-CCD-NN-S-NN-FW is a drive controller module produced by Bosch Rexroth Indramat for the CSH Advanced Controllers series. Installed in an IndraDrive power section, the module supervises axis motion, processes feedback, and exchanges status data with the plant control layer. Its role in industrial automation is to generate reference values, interpret encoder signals, and coordinate local I/O so servo motors follow commanded profiles with tight positional accuracy while the controller manages axis-related data inside the drive system.
This control unit includes one analog output that operates from 0 to +5 V with a resolution of 19.5 mV/inc, allowing a downstream drive or sensor to receive finely scaled reference levels. Base electronics draw only 8.5 W during idle operation, yet at power-up the circuitry can momentarily demand 4 A of inrush current, a figure that must be considered when selecting cabinet fusing. Sixteen parallel digital inputs and sixteen parallel digital outputs are available through the onboard Parallel Interface, giving direct bit-level interaction with limit switches or actuators. An RS-232 service port supports diagnostics at a maximum rate of 115 kBaud, so parameter updates can be transferred quickly. The TTL encoder channel accepts feedback up to 400 kHz, and the integrated standard encoder evaluation circuit processes these pulses in real time.
Network synchronization between neighboring controller cards is handled by a front-panel connector that uses a RJ-45 8-pin form factor and transmits over 100Base-TX lines in compliance with the IEEE 802.3 standard for Ethernet communication. For sensor power, the board supplies encoders with up to 500 mA at a stabilized output of 11.6 V, which helps prevent voltage sag on long cable runs. Relay logic can switch loads rated at 24 V DC and 1 A, permitting direct control of brakes or contactors without auxiliary relays.
